Voltage Thresholds of PFC Capacitors

Capacitors installed in power factor correction (PFC) schemes must survive the charge pressure applied during operation. The voltage level of a capacitor states the maximum peak of voltage it can safely handle without breakdown. Handling a PFC capacitor at or passing beyond its rated voltage can lead to critical damage, including electrical failures and potential fire hazards. Therefore, determining capacitors with an proper voltage rating is crucial for confirming the robustness of the PFC layout and preventing unanticipated consequences. It is recommended to consult the blueprints provided by the capacitor producer to calculate the optimal voltage rating required for your distinct PFC exercise.

Metal-Clad Switchgear Examination and Maintenance

Adequate care of metal-cased switchgear is essential for maintaining the uninterrupted service of your electrical arrangement. Systematic evaluations allow you to observe potential failures before they trigger costly halted operations. While conducting these inspections, it's imperative to closely check all items, including connections, insulators, and operating mechanisms. Look for signs of damage, loose linkages, or any other deviations. Keep in mind that vendor advice should always be followed for specific prescribed maintenance programs. Thorough documentation of all data is necessary for tracking the reliability of your switchgear over time. This documentation assists future maintenance and repair efforts.
